What is your policy on handling double-coated breeds common in Iowa, like Huskies or Shelties, to ensure their coat is properly maintained for our climate?

We follow a strict 'no shaving' policy for double-coated breeds. Our groomers are trained in specialized de-shedding techniques that remove the dead undercoat without damaging the protective top coat, which is essential for regulating your pet's body temperature through both our humid summers and cold Blakesburg winters.

Beyond the Kennel: Why Blakesburg Pet Owners Are Choosing Spa Boarding for Their Dogs

For pet owners in Blakesburg, Iowa, planning a trip often comes with a familiar pang of guilt. Who will care for your furry family member? The traditional kennel can feel stark and stressful, especially for our dogs who are used to the quiet comfort of our homes and the wide-open spaces of our Southern Iowa countryside. But there’s a new standard of care emerging, one that turns a necessary service into a true retreat: dog spa boarding. It’s more than just a place to stay; it’s an experience designed to keep your dog happy, healthy, and pampered while you’re away.

So, what exactly is dog spa boarding? Imagine your dog enjoying a cozy, suite-like environment instead of a concrete run. They receive personalized attention, with plenty of playtime and cuddles. The "spa" component means that their stay includes rejuvenating extras—perhaps a soothing oatmeal bath after a romp at the Blakesburg Ballpark, a blueberry facial to cleanse away pollen from a hike at Lake Fisher, or a gentle pawdicure. It’s about addressing the whole dog, reducing the anxiety of separation with comfort and positive engagement.

For our active Blakesburg dogs, this holistic approach is a game-changer. Our pets explore gravel roads, fields, and maybe even the Sugar Creek. A spa boarding facility understands these local realities. They can offer a de-shedding treatment during spring when the golden retrievers are "blowing their coats," or a moisturizing treatment for paws that get dry from our varied Iowa weather. It’s care that’s attentive to the specific needs of dogs living the good life in Wapello County.

When you’re considering a spa boarding facility, don’t be shy about asking the right questions. Visit the location, just like you would for any family member's care. Ask about their daily routine, staff-to-dog ratios, and what specific spa services are included in the boarding stay. A reputable provider will be thrilled to show you where your dog will sleep, play, and relax. Mention your dog’s local habits—do they come home from the park with burrs? A good spa will have a plan for that.
